Generation of superoxide radicals in electron transport reactions of bacterial photosynthesis

The authors investigate the formation of O/sup -//sub 2/ in the light reactions of the chromatophores of nonsulfur purple bacteria Rhodospirillum rubrum and Rhodopseudomonas sphaeroides using an ESR probe - tyron - and an absorption indicator - epinephrine. Using the data of inhibitor analysis, it is concluded that O/sup -//sub 2/ is formed in the autooxidation of the primary quinone of the reaction center (one-electron ubiquinone) and a low-potential semiquinone, formed in the oxidation of the bound quinone A /SUB z/ .
